Output e3d1383704715ef62da5b85805c164ea27dac52c629d154378523c52484d4110:0

value
26009
script pubkey
OP_0 OP_PUSHBYTES_20 2ab351f3579bff63e31ce093777e9a7d2a2cdfa1
address
bc1q92e4ru6hn0lk8ccuuzfhwl56054zehapccgdmt
transaction
e3d1383704715ef62da5b85805c164ea27dac52c629d154378523c52484d4110
confirmations
256383
spent
true